summaryrefslogtreecommitdiff
AgeCommit message (Collapse)Author
2019-07-09Snap for 5715241 from 261a2d62e2e97aa89286412aa9e36953da92c156 to qt-aml-releaseandroid-mainline-10.0.0_r3android-mainline-10.0.0_r1android10-mainline-releaseandroid-build-team Robot
Change-Id: I2e3aead0f82aa27113cf37f38d958983e61855ee
2019-07-09Merge "Update docs for UID_STATE" into qt-devTreeHugger Robot
2019-07-09Snap for 5713174 from 6f672a38356457bd23c89efaa8f1b89953843662 to qt-aml-releaseandroid-build-team Robot
Change-Id: I7ce981c863458fe839e9bf416442801db535a05a
2019-07-08Specify the duration time baseSvet Ganov
Test: N/A Bug: 128316830 Change-Id: Idd8f1aaf1a8e0013c01fdf4d668f9d5e81101559
2019-07-08Update docs for UID_STATESvet Ganov
Test: N/A Bug: 128919932 Change-Id: Ibac690db3b58293082f762800bbbff0f832a16b2
2019-07-08Merge "Do not trigger revoke-perm callbacks if no change" into qt-devPhilip P. Moltmann
2019-07-08Merge "GestureExclusion: Fix restriction priority" into qt-devTreeHugger Robot
2019-07-06Snap for 5709920 from b37de73103e2b155dbd77909587d65cf390f0d6e to qt-aml-releaseandroid-build-team Robot
Change-Id: Iccacbb782d8dfd69a354a571d34a305b7835ef80
2019-07-06Merge "Import translations. DO NOT MERGE" into qt-devTreeHugger Robot
2019-07-05Import translations. DO NOT MERGEBill Yi
Auto-generated-cl: translation import Bug: 64712476 Change-Id: I634b80fa18b8f14a90e5494933bf9b49a4c3f68f
2019-07-04GestureExclusion: Fix restriction priorityAdrian Roos
Bottom restrictions should be applied first. Bug: 135522625 Test: adb shell setprop debug.pointerlocation.showexclusion true; adb shell stop; adb shell start; open app excluding entire edge, verify bottom part is applied. Change-Id: Ifc2bc64b1ce3132f198e23ae8e271380acf0c5a1
2019-07-04GestureNav: Fix broken exclusion rect calculation for modal windowsAdrian Roos
Fixes an issue with non-fullscreen modal windows (such as dialogs), where the touch exclusion of the window behind was still being applied, even though the window behind did not actually receive the touches in the exclusion, because they would go to the modal window in front. Bug: 135522625 Test: atest testCalculateSystemGestureExclusion_modal Change-Id: Ia99f4f601e780715abaf966f6f297fd9d555fd0b
2019-07-04Merge "WM: implicitly exclude all edges for pre-Q immersive sticky apps" ↵TreeHugger Robot
into qt-dev
2019-07-04WM: implicitly exclude all edges for pre-Q immersive sticky appsAdrian Roos
Bug: 135522625 Test: atest DisplayContentTests Change-Id: Ibe6c2c6d269b15c2e79ac0241b93e42c44a167c9 Exempt-From-Owner-Approval: TBR
2019-07-03[automerger skipped] Revert "Do not load xml metadata for unchanged packages ↵Dmitry Dementyev
in RegisteredServicesCache" am: c0e4ee7332 -s ours am skip reason: change_id I2f78f0dbbace212309b87f779efad020cf255196 with SHA1 40431ae1bc is in history Change-Id: I2f6d0b75851879f84167c689802a98645d96d3c1
2019-07-04Snap for 5706892 from 5540281a6d3868ea425f774d0ac4d314ed7d5458 to qt-aml-releaseandroid-build-team Robot
Change-Id: I0b7d75b12d867486544ded0910a66a432616d967
2019-07-04Merge "Change NVHM protection from crash to Log.wtf" into qt-devTreeHugger Robot
2019-07-03Do not trigger revoke-perm callbacks if no changePhilip P. Moltmann
Revoking a permission might e.g. kill the the app. If a permission gets revoked that was never granted there was no change, hence no need to call the callbacks and also no need to kill the app. Test: "pm clear" two times in a row. The second one did trigger a kill before, not anymore. Bug: 133830856 Change-Id: I357f2d939520ac78ef82ecf4feb7936455950fc4
2019-07-03Merge "Media2: Make Javadoc consistent for recommending use of AndroidX" ↵TreeHugger Robot
into qt-dev
2019-07-03Merge "Resolver - 'Always' button broken for non VIEW cases" into qt-devMatt Pietal
2019-07-03Merge "Revert "Preload sfplugin_ccodec for performance"" into qt-devTreeHugger Robot
2019-07-03Merge "Import translations. DO NOT MERGE" into qt-devTreeHugger Robot
2019-07-03Revert "Preload sfplugin_ccodec for performance"Ray Essick
This reverts commit 30da74bda4106515c18147edf004bbe021d0d27e. Reason for revert: occasional audio race, losing volume control for device Bug: 133186424 Bug: 135763139 Change-Id: I3aca2780dfcf80cfe0095af2a40496f3af0733cd
2019-07-03Merge "Import translations. DO NOT MERGE" into qt-devTreeHugger Robot
2019-07-03Resolver - 'Always' button broken for non VIEW casesMatt Pietal
Users are incorrectly being directed to the settings app when selecting 'Always', making them unable to actually open an app through the resolver. Bug: 132071949 Test: Steps are reported in b/136451610 Change-Id: I11775d7b0b780195f08273ad2b90b8ecd2ee1db4
2019-07-03Merge "Avoid making post state to RESUMED for a PAUSING activity" into qt-devTreeHugger Robot
2019-07-03Media2: Make Javadoc consistent for recommending use of AndroidXJaewan Kim
Bug: 136602530 Test: Build docs offline and checked manually. Change-Id: I70df7b05a6749b9ba492ac03cd3b9179a7416b9c
2019-07-02Import translations. DO NOT MERGEBill Yi
Auto-generated-cl: translation import Bug: 64712476 Change-Id: Id195d54ad8e39a06ee00a25ce3330ba42f8b0412
2019-07-02Import translations. DO NOT MERGEBill Yi
Auto-generated-cl: translation import Bug: 64712476 Change-Id: I6733160ff966884bc25bbe16caa37515eb163921
2019-07-03Merge "Fix sms app changed broadcast" into qt-devEugene Susla
2019-07-03Snap for 5704982 from 660c234e9ad68cd23feb2e22cb43bd7a645b24e6 to qt-aml-releaseandroid-build-team Robot
Change-Id: I0ec6e88a614ee1ad5a0b3069030bbf39ebc65034
2019-07-03Avoid making post state to RESUMED for a PAUSING activityLouis Chang
Make sure the client post execution lifecycle state to RESUMED only if the activity was RESUMED while delivering new intent. Bug: 135715788 Test: making skype calls Test: atest ActivityThreadTest Change-Id: I1e3054e1d1611aecf6ddf6d482abf2cb3ebdf9a4
2019-07-02Merge "Revert "Do not load xml metadata for unchanged packages in ↵Dmitry Dementyev
RegisteredServicesCache"" into qt-dev
2019-07-02Merge "Fix mobile data usage didn't get increased for xlat464 traffic" into ↵Maciej Zenczykowski
qt-dev
2019-07-02Fix sms app changed broadcastEugene Susla
Fixes: 136257475 Test: switch sms holder in settings, and ensure ceceived broadcasts for both becoming and leaving the sms app status Change-Id: I10dda3fd8ebd38ab12bdb8192ed4f3863f4238b8
2019-07-02Merge "Change quick setting min_num_tiles number and text to resources ↵TreeHugger Robot
value." into qt-dev
2019-07-02Merge "Check that alpha is zero instead of transparent color to decide ↵Winson Chung
scrim" into qt-dev
2019-07-02Merge "Preload sfplugin_ccodec for performance" into qt-devRay Essick
2019-07-02Merge "Set idmap2 binary uid and gid after forking" into qt-devTreeHugger Robot
2019-07-02Merge "Sharesheet - Fix regression in direct share sorting" into qt-devMatt Pietal
2019-07-02Fix mobile data usage didn't get increased for xlat464 trafficjunyulai
Interface stats on stacked interfaces is usually clatd. For xt_qtaguid supported device, the stats is already accounted against its final egress interface by the kernel. Framework side does not need to handle stats on statcked interface at all. However, on devices that support BPF offload, xlat464 packets are seen by the iptables rules as arriving on stack interface only. Thus, add stack interface into accounting is needed. Bug: 136193260 Test: 1. atest FrameworksNetTests 2. atest android.app.usage.cts.NetworkUsageStatsTest 3. manual test on ipv6-only wifi network Merged-In: I8ebbefbe4df00e40f4896a17fa52c8438d41286e Change-Id: I8ebbefbe4df00e40f4896a17fa52c8438d41286e (cherry-pick from aosp/1009306) (cherry picked from commit feb79bd0d7c5ecc7ac5ba9f54ed2d51ee9fd7e74)
2019-07-02Revert "Do not load xml metadata for unchanged packages in ↵Dmitry Dementyev
RegisteredServicesCache" This reverts commit 8094880025d0680ec4cf586929d85b9050d4e9d6. Reason for revert: changed services order Test: manual Bug: 136261465 Change-Id: I2f78f0dbbace212309b87f779efad020cf255196
2019-07-02Prevent system server crash while start activity failed.wilsonshih
NPE at PendingActivityLaunch#sendErrorResult, callerApp can be null. Bug: 135648362 Test: atest ActivityStarterTests Change-Id: I7949dc1effcc171834f6bc3ff0333f9090b58480 Merged-In: I7949dc1effcc171834f6bc3ff0333f9090b58480 (cherry picked from commit 0c0fb22eabf8bb654dfd93ff1b0ef86afbb76e14)
2019-07-02Snap for 5702388 from bce828f157d905bc7f731fc400bdc0466bdfbfa1 to qt-aml-releaseandroid-build-team Robot
Change-Id: Icdc93783eb1becab6f2c98c7f0b22817f92ee907
2019-07-01Check that alpha is zero instead of transparent color to decide scrimWinson Chung
Bug: 136370711 Test: atest EnsureBarContrastTest Change-Id: I45c4a81d5e7fe6f99615efca528a623f3830f16a
2019-07-01Set idmap2 binary uid and gid after forkingRyan Mitchell
The file permissions of the idmap2 binary are currently not set correctly when the system forks and execs the idmap binary during zygote. This chnages sets the uid and gid after forking to the same uid and gid of the parent process. Bug: 134897503 Test: device boots and generates idmap Change-Id: Ic7fac49e5982f3c47713603b905c3a6be117a05b
2019-07-01Merge "Delay possible re-entrant call to updateNotificationViews()" into qt-devTreeHugger Robot
2019-07-01Sharesheet - Fix regression in direct share sortingMatt Pietal
When mutiple apps share shortcuts and are given to the UI to display, the ranked order from both the App Prediction Service and the legacy ranker is inadvertently being discarded. This means that targets the user almost never uses will now be shown as high priority, causing confusion and pretty horrible user experience. Address the issue by adding in a score for shortcuts, based on the index in the ordered list. Bug: 136201796 Test: atest ChooserActivityTest and manually compare results from AppPredictionService to verify order is consistent Change-Id: I1fe2c2d2e13195f6f6c3a5818fade4844c15488e
2019-07-01Revert "Do not load xml metadata for unchanged packages in ↵Dmitry Dementyev
RegisteredServicesCache" This reverts commit 8094880025d0680ec4cf586929d85b9050d4e9d6. Reason for revert: changed services order Test: manual Bug: 136261465 Change-Id: I2f78f0dbbace212309b87f779efad020cf255196 Merged-In: I2f78f0dbbace212309b87f779efad020cf255196
2019-07-01Merge "Call syncInputWindows after calling transferTouchFocus" into qt-devChavi Weingarten